Kickinger Beton
Kickinger Beton is in Neulengbach, St. Pölten District, Lower Austria, and is located on Tullner Straße. Kickinger Beton is situated nearby to the fire station Freiwillige Feuerwehr Markersdorf, as well as near the village Maria Anzbach.Places of Interest Nearby
